Exploring the DMAIC Project Methodology

The DMAIC project methodology is a well-defined framework widely utilized to enhance processes and achieve significant improvements. Acronym standing for Define, Measure, Analyze, Improve, and Control, each phase plays a crucial role in driving successful outcomes. By following this structured approach, organizations can effectively address complex challenges, streamline operations, and ultimately achieve their goals. The DMAIC methodology provides a roadmap for data-driven decision making, fostering a culture of continuous improvement.

  • Leading, the Define phase involves clearly articulating the project scope, goals, and customer requirements.
  • Subsequently, the Measure phase focuses on collecting relevant data to quantify the current state of the process.
  • During the Analyze phase, professionals delve into the data to pinpoint root causes of any deficiencies.
  • This Improve phase centers on creating solutions to eliminate identified issues and improve the process.
  • Finally, the Control phase aims to sustain the improvements over time through monitoring, documentation, and modifications as needed.

Planning Projects Made Easy: The DMAIC Approach

Embarking on a new project can feel overwhelming, but with the right approach, you can navigate the process with confidence and achieve your goals. Enter DMAIC, a data-driven improvement framework that breaks down project planning into structured phases. DMAIC stands for Define, Measure, Analyze, Improve, and Control, each stage providing a clear roadmap to success.

  • Define: Start by identifying your project's objectives, scope, and key stakeholders. This sets the foundation for effective execution.
  • Measure: Gather relevant data to understand your current state and identify areas for improvement. This provides a baseline for tracking progress.
  • Analyze: Dive into the data gathered in the previous stage to reveal root causes of any problems or inefficiencies.
  • Improve: Design solutions to address the identified issues and streamline processes for greater effectiveness.
  • Control: Put in place systems to ensure that improvements are sustained over time. This includes evaluating performance and making adjustments as needed.

By following the DMAIC framework, you can build a robust project plan that minimizes risks, optimizes efficiency, and ultimately leads to successful outcomes.
